Transaction 1419c8415248f83cfe59bf2b69c352a2a4f6612211a95318f17cc6c1a51a6e52

1 Input
2 Outputs
  • 1419c8415248f83cfe59bf2b69c352a2a4f6612211a95318f17cc6c1a51a6e52:0
  • value  11933363
    address  348e52WdY417Eh3aeYxsBpeLgFP8VMbkky
  • 1419c8415248f83cfe59bf2b69c352a2a4f6612211a95318f17cc6c1a51a6e52:1
  • value  20833
    address  1DySpu39ehcvzbXuPoShbeyCcVxbb7hFeT